Applying Gamma and Histogram Equalization Algorithms for Improving System-performance of Face Recognition-based CNN

Abstract

n the last few years, many applications have viewed great development, such as smart city applications, social media, smartphones, security systems, etc. In most of these applications, facial recognition played a major role. The work of these applications begins by locating the face within the image and then recognizing the face. The circumstances surrounding the person at the moment of taking the picture greatly affect the accuracy of these applications, especially the inappropriate lighting. Therefore, the stage of preparing the images is very important in the work. To solve this problem, we proposed a system that combines the use of gamma and Histogram Equalization algorithm (HE) to improve the images before starting to detect the face using the Viola-Jones. Then extract the facial features and identify the person using convolutional neural networks. The proposed system achieved a very small error rate and an accuracy during training that reached 100%.
